Our verdict is Benign. Variant got -7 ACMG points: 2P and 9B. PM2BP4_ModerateBP6_ModerateBP7BS1

The NM_001164665.2(KIAA1549):​c.5832C>T​(p.Thr1944Thr) variant causes a synonymous change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.000093 in 1,613,666 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. Variant has been reported in ClinVar as Likely benign (★).

Genes affected
KIAA1549 (HGNC:22219): (KIAA1549) The protein encoded by this gene belongs to the UPF0606 family. This gene has been found to be fused to the BRAF oncogene in many cases of pilocytic astrocytoma. The fusion results from 2Mb tandem duplications at 7q34. Alternative splicing results in multiple transcript variants. [provided by RefSeq, Oct 2012]
TMEM213 (HGNC:27220): (transmembrane protein 213) Predicted to be integral component of membrane. [provided by Alliance of Genome Resources, Apr 2022]
